Associate applicants have rated the interview process at Hines with 3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 50% positive. To compare, the company-average is 64.5%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Associate roles take an average of 29 days to get hired, when considering 2 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Hines overall takes an average of 29 days.

The interview process unfolded in a straightforward manner, characterized by an amiable atmosphere and an intriguing glimpse into the workings of the firm. Interactions with the interviewers spanned a diverse array of subjects, delving into facets such as professional experience, core skills, and behavioral attributes. During the course of the interview, there was an in-depth exploration of my background, where we delved into the intricacies of my past professional endeavors, and a comprehensive discussion ensued regarding my accumulated experience and overarching career objectives.

Several interviews with top and middle management, case study with a investment memo and model built, fit interview with peers. Knowledge and experience assessment. Hobbies and personal questions also made.
